NCP612, NCV612 Voltage Regulator - CMOS, Low Iq, SC70-5 100 mA The NCP612/NCV612 series of fixed output linear regulators are www.onsemi.com designed for handheld communication equipment and portable battery powered applications which require low quiescent. The NCP612/NCV612 series features an ultralow quiescent current of 40 A. Each device contains a voltage reference unit, an error amplifier, a PMOS power transistor, resistors for setting output SC705 voltage, current limit, and temperature limit protection circuits. CASE 419A The NCP612/NCV612 has been designed to be used with low cost ceramic capacitors. The device is housed in the microminiature PIN CONNECTIONS SC705 surface mount package. Standard voltage versions are 1.5, 1.8, 2.5, 2.7, 2.8, 3.0, 3.1, 3.3, 3.7, and 5.0 V. Typical Application Diagram Semiconductor Components Industries, LLC, 2013 1 Publication Order Number: October, 2019 Rev. 4 NCP612/DNCP612, NCV612 PIN FUNCTION DESCRIPTION Pin No. Pin Name Description 1 Vin Positive power supply input voltage. 2 Gnd Power supply ground. 3 Enable This input is used to place the device into low power standby. When this input is pulled low, the device is disabled. If this function is not used, Enable should be connected to Vin. 4 N/C No internal connection. 5 Vout Regulated output voltage.
